DuoRacer MPPT charge controller is made for charging two batteries at the same time in a solar system. This controller supports multiple battery types, including Sealed, Gel, Flooded, LiFePO4, and Li-NiCoMn. The device recognizes the start battery system voltage automatically, and trickle charges the battery when the required.
MPPT Solar controllers (Maximum Power Point Tracking) can intelligently regulate the working voltage of solar panels, letting the solar panels always work at Maximum Power Point of V-A curve. Compared with ordinary solar controller, this MPPT controller can increase the efficiency of PV modules by 10% to 30%.
The Dual Battery MPPT Solar Charge Controller adopts the advanced MPPT control algorithm, which will minimize the maximum power point loss rate and loss time, also fast track the maximum power point (MPP) of the PV array, and obtain the maximum energy from solar array under any conditions. The energy utilization in the MPPT solar system is increased by 20-30% compared with PWM charging method. The controller features a low-power mode, which reduces standby current when the unit is idle preventing power waste and helping to enhance the products life. The system parameters are shown and set by LED/LCD or the MT11 remote meter (Accessory).
Monitoring of the system can be made easy with the optional remote meter or via Apple & Android smartphones, tablets, macbooks and other devices, using the optional Bluetooth Adapter.

① Life battery (BATT1) is the energy storage battery for powering the household loads in the off-grid system, which supports Sealed, Gel, Flooded, LiFePO4, and Li-NiCoMn batteries (the controller can NOT recognize the system voltage automatically).
② Start battery (BATT2) is the energy storage battery which usually built in the vehicle for powering the system such as RV and Boat, and only supports lead-acid battery (the controller will recognize the system voltage automatically).
NOTE: the BATT1 and BATT2 must be at the same voltage level.

The BatteryProtect disconnects the battery from non essential loads before it is completely discharged (which would damage the battery) or before it has insufficient power left to crank the engine.

Features
12/24V auto ranging
The BatteryProtect automatically detects system voltage
Programming made easy
The BatteryProtect can be set to engage / disengage at several different voltages. The seven segment display will indicate which setting has been chosen.
A special setting for Li-ion batteries
In this mode the BatteryProtect can be controlled by the VE.Bus BMS. Note: the BatteryProtect can also be used as a charge interrupter in between a battery charger and a Li-ion battery. See connection diagram in the manual.
Ultra low current consumption
This is important in case of Li-ion batteries, especially after low voltage shutdown. Please see our Li-ion battery datasheet and the VE.Bus BMS manual for more information.
Over voltage protection
To prevent damage to sensitive loads due to over voltage, the load is disconnected whenever the DC voltage exceeds 16V respectively 32V.
Ignition proof
No relays but MOSFET switches, and therefore no sparks.
Delayed alarm output
The alarm output is activated if the battery voltage drops below the preset disconnect level during more than 12 seconds. Starting the engine will therefore not activate the alarm. The alarm output is a short circuit proof open collector output to the negative (minus) rail, max. current 50 mA. The alarm output is typically used to activate a buzzer, LED or relay.
Delayed load disconnect and delayed reconnect
The load will be disconnected 90 seconds after the alarm has been activated. If the battery voltage increases again to the connect threshold within this time period (after the engine has been started for example), the load will not be disconnected. The load will be reconnected 30 seconds after the battery voltage has increased to more than the preset reconnect voltage.

The Digital Multi Control panel (DMC) is a remote panel designed to work with all of Victron Energy's Multi & Quattro inverter/chargers (including the Multiplus range). The DMC can remotely turn the Multis or Quattros on or off (or set them to charger-only mode), display the status of the charger and inverter functions and set up to four different AC input current limits (plus one generator input).
